Finding reference regions based on structural similarities


A key to build sound innovation strategies for smart specialisation at the regional level is to identify opportunities for learning policy lessons and transferring practices from other regions. But what are the regions one should consider as a reference for these purposes? Our proposal is to start by identifying regions that share similar structural conditions which are relevant for innovation-driven development (social, economic, technological, institutional and geographical characteristics). That is, characteristics that cannot be easily changed in the short term and that are demonstrated to affect the way innovation and economic evolution take place in a region. Below you will find an interactive tool that allows you to identify reference regions across Europe based on a methodology jointly developed by Orkestra – Basque Institute of Competitiveness and the S3 Platform.

How it works

  1. Select a region in the top window
  2. Choose the number of reference regions you want to be displayed
  3. Decide if you want to exclude regions from the same country from the results
  4. Press “refresh” to get the results
  5. A list of regions will appear on the right side of the screen sorted in descending order from the ones that are more similar (top) to the less similar (bottom) to the region selected
  6. The order is given by a synthetic index of structural distance (lower value=structurally closer to the selected region) explained in the methodological paper.
